App spotlight: DODO

An interview with 0x integrator DODO, an on-chain decentralized exchange and liquidity provider for everyone.

August 10, 2021

Powered by 0x

Welcome to the 0x spotlight series, where we highlight some of the exciting and novel projects built on 0x. Next up is DODO! DODO is an on-chain decentralized exchange that leverages Swap API to provide traders with the best prices. We chatted with the DODO team about the importance of multi-chain development, what they are currently working on, and why they decided to integrate Swap API.

Enjoy the interview!

What is DODO?

DODO is a decentralized exchange platform that provides an alternative both to the classic and convenient centralized exchange and to other DEXes, which usually suffer from low liquidity, high volatility, and confusing user interfaces.

With the help of our innovative Proactive Marker Maker (PMM), DODO uses oracles to dynamically determine the actual price of a crypto asset, which results in lower slippage and reduced impermanent loss compared to AMM platforms. DODO is also a liquidity source aggregator, using the SmartTrade feature to intelligently find the best order routing from those sources to give traders the best prices.

In January of 2021, DODO launched its unique Crowdpooling feature, which is a liquidity offering mechanic that allows issuers to be able to offer assets at a low cost and to provide highly liquid capital pools for investors. Investors also benefit from Crowdpooling, as they are reassured by its guaranteed liquidity protection period and resistance to bot interference and frontrunning. Crowdpooling represents the next step in DODO’s mission to provide a platform where anyone can participate, without hesitation, in the nascent DeFi ecosystem.

DODO recently launched on Polygon in a major step toward the multi-chain future. Why is multi-chain development an important part of DODO’s mission and what has the response been so far?

Multi-chain development really gets to the heart of what DODO is all about. In a crypto economy where users want both great DeFi services on multiple blockchains and scaling solution platforms simultaneously, we must be proactive in making our innovative technology available to as many people as possible. This strategy involves integrating our infrastructure with both L1 and L2 chains, as well as with sidechains.

On the L1 front, DODO is already integrated with Ethereum, Binance Smart Chain, and the Huobi ECO, and, as of May of 2021, has been deployed to Moonbeam’s Moonbase Alpha testnet. DODO’s V1 and V2 smart contracts are also fully deployed on Arbitrum, a major L2 chain designed to make Ethereum-based transactions fast and affordable. More recently, DODO announced its deployment on Polygon’s PoS sidechain, which is a framework for building and connecting Ethereum-​compatible blockchain networks.

DODO has seen an overall upward trend in trading volume since we began implementing our multi-chain strategy in February, with dramatic jumps in volume after deploying on BSC and Polygon and a generally steady rise throughout. In recent weeks, our approximately 1,700 trades per day have been split around 60:40 between the ETH and BSC mainnets, respectively, with Polygon accounting for the remaining volume. Our TVL has also been on the rise during this period, and it’s almost evenly split between the ETH and BSC mainnets.

Why did you choose to integrate Swap API?

The most beneficial feature of Swap API for us has been how remarkably easy it is to integrate with DODO. Since 0x has integrated nearly all the mainstream liquidity sources in DeFi, including Sushiswap and Uniswap, it already supports the three major networks that DODO is deployed on, namely Ethereum, Binance Smart Chain, and Polygon.

As a result, our devs have a lot of work already done for them and are able to direct more of their efforts to developing what makes DODO unique.

It’s also critical for us that Swap API is very stable and responsive - qualities that are essential for any financial service. Both DODO’s frontend trading portal and DODO’s trading API use Swap API extensively. DODO's trading API is also an aggregator, which sources liquidity from several APIs, one of which is the Swap API, as well as DODO's own routing algorithm. The ability to compare prices from various liquidity sources at the same time gives DODO the ability to provide the best price quote to traders.

Do you have any advice for anyone considering building a DeFi app using Swap API?

The DODO team recommends going through Swap API’s official API specification documentation. It is an excellent resource and a great starting point for DeFi builders looking to leverage Swap API.

What’s next for DODO?

DODO is closely monitoring market trends and focusing on innovations that can help improve the quality of life for DeFi natives and provide access to financial services for all. Currently, we are working on optimizing our trading API and SDK, deploying onto more blockchain networks, researching the potential for limit orders, and developing the DODO NFT platform. Our team is actively hiring developers, marketing professionals, and community ambassadors.

Where can people go to learn more about DODO?

All the information you need can be found on the DODO website. It features a technical documentation section called ‘DODO Docs’ and a guide for beginners called the ‘DODO Dojo’. Everyone is welcome to join the DODO Discord and community forum to participate in discussions about the platform and to get involved with our social media presence on sites such as Twitter and Medium.

Thanks to the DODO team for chatting!

Ready to start building?
Create a 0x account and get started, for free, in less than five minutes.

Contents

Subscribe to newsletter

By submitting you're confirming that you agree with our Terms and Conditions.
Yay! You’re signed up.
Oops! Something went wrong, but it's not your fault.

Up next

Fundamentals: Smart Contract Wallets

Oct 15, 2024

Compliance made easy with 0x Address Screening

Sep 26, 2024

0x's next-gen pricing engine is now live

Sep 25, 2024

Introducing state-of-the-art Buy/Sell Tax support

Sep 4, 2024

Take control of your balance sheet with 0x v2

Aug 15, 2024

0x v2 bug bounty program

Jul 30, 2024

What does the "best price" in DeFi really mean?

Jul 23, 2024

Eliminate allowance risk with Permit2

Jul 17, 2024

Introducing 0x's next-gen pricing engine

Jul 15, 2024

0x Dev Digest: May 2024

May 31, 2024

Frame spotlight: Paycaster

May 21, 2024

Frame spotlight: Airstack

May 9, 2024

Power up your Farcaster Frames with 0x swaps

May 2, 2024

0x Dev Digest: April 2024

Apr 30, 2024

Introducing 0x Trade Analytics

Mar 12, 2024

Coinbase Case Study

Jan 30, 2024

Introducing gasless swaps and approvals with Gasless API

Jan 22, 2024

Bitcoin ETFs have arrived

Jan 12, 2024

Building in the open: 0x pricing update

Dec 11, 2023

Matcha leverages Gasless API to bring users the most frictionless trading experience in DeFi

Nov 30, 2023

0x Dev Digest: October 2023

Nov 2, 2023

Monetize crypto trading in your app with Swap API

Oct 26, 2023

0x Dev Digest: September 2023

Oct 3, 2023

A comprehensive analysis of RFQ performance

Sep 26, 2023

Unlock optimal trades in Swap API with 0x RFQ liquidity

Sep 20, 2023

0x Dev Digest: August 2023

Aug 31, 2023

Portal launches swaps in its white label MPC wallet powered by 0x

Aug 16, 2023

0x Swap API is now live on Base

Aug 9, 2023

Introducing paid plans for Swap API

Jul 24, 2023

Decreasing Frictions in DeFi hackathon recap

Jul 12, 2023

0x's pricing principles

Jul 3, 2023

0x Dev Digest: June 2023

Jun 30, 2023

App spotlight: tastycrypto

Jun 27, 2023

App spotlight: 31Third

Jun 22, 2023

0x 101: Intro to gasless API

Jun 13, 2023

Inspiration for building with Swap API

Jun 8, 2023

0x Dev Digest: May 2023

May 31, 2023

Fundamentals: What are gas fees?

May 25, 2023

Decreasing Frictions in DeFi Hackathon

May 12, 2023

Swap API liquidity management

May 18, 2023

0x 101: Getting started with Swap API

May 16, 2023

0x 101: Intro to Swap API

May 9, 2023

0x 101: Intro to 0x Orders

May 4, 2023

0x 101: Intro to 0x Protocol

Apr 27, 2023

A new home for 0x Protocol

Apr 24, 2023

Say hi to the new 0x

Apr 20, 2023

0x Year in Review 2022

Jan 5, 2023

0x Swap API expands to Arbitrum

Sep 22, 2022

Managed liquidity

Apr 23, 2020

0x Smart Order Routing

May 19, 2020

App spotlight: Taho

Mar 8, 2022

Fundamentals: What is a Layer 2 chain?

Apr 19, 2023

Fundamentals: What is the difference between quoted, executed, and adjusted prices?

Apr 19, 2023

Fundamentals: What is price impact?

Apr 19, 2023

Fundamentals: What is slippage?

Apr 19, 2023

Fundamentals: What is an automated market maker (AMM)?

Apr 19, 2023

Fundamentals: What is market making?

Apr 19, 2023

Fundamentals: What is a DEX aggregator?

Apr 19, 2023

Fundamentals: What is liquidity?

Apr 19, 2023

Fundamentals: What is a decentralized exchange (DEX)?

Apr 19, 2023

0x at ETHDenver 2023

Mar 21, 2023

The 0x Mission and Values

Jun 7, 2018

Announcing support for new testnets

Aug 10, 2022

0x Swap API expands to Binance Smart Chain

Mar 17, 2021

Scaling DeFi — Layer One

Sep 1, 2021

Introducing Slippage Protection

Jul 14, 2022

San Francisco Blockchain Week 2022 Recap

Nov 21, 2022

0x Swap API adds new liquidity sources

Jul 11, 2022

Review of slippage performance

Sep 14, 2022

Phuture case study

Oct 20, 2022

Measuring the impact of hidden DEX costs

Apr 14, 2022

Market making in DeFi

Aug 12, 2021

Introducing 0x Labs

Jun 22, 2020

Introducing 0x Explorer

Oct 26, 2022

Growing DeFi with professional market makers

Aug 26, 2020

0x 101: How to Access 0x Data

Apr 25, 2023

GameStop chooses 0x Swap API

Jul 8, 2022

Build on Base with 0x

Feb 23, 2023

A comprehensive analysis on DEX liquidity aggregators’ performance

Oct 1, 2020

Announcing 0x Swap API v1

Oct 1, 2020

Access all DEX liquidity through 0x Swap API

Jan 28, 2020

Announcing the 0xpo Summit 2022

Aug 24, 2022

0x Protocol, a preview of what’s to come

Mar 16, 2023

Update to our Privacy Policy

Mar 14, 2023

Price Impact Protection has arrived

Dec 14, 2022

0x Limit Orders Go Multi-Chain

Dec 23, 2021

0x Labs raises $70M Series B led by Greylock to continue expanding Web3’s core exchange infrastructure

Apr 26, 2022

0x launches Tx Relay API in beta, with Robinhood Wallet as first partner

Mar 1, 2023

0x Labs raises $15M Series A to bring decentralized exchange markets to a global audience

Feb 5, 2021

App spotlight: Zerion

Jun 22, 2022

App spotlight: Matcha

Nov 24, 2021

App spotlight: DexGuru

Jun 17, 2021

App spotlight: DEXTools

Sep 23, 2021

App spotlight: DappRadar

Dec 16, 2021

App spotlight: DeFi Saver

Jul 20, 2021

0x + Brave partner to make crypto and DeFi more accessible to everyone

Jul 7, 2021

0x Swap API now supports 0x Protocol v4

Mar 1, 2021

0x Swap API is now available on Fantom

Oct 26, 2021

0x Swap API is now live on Optimism

Jan 11, 2022

0x Swap API is now available on Polygon

May 31, 2021